Charles Hardin Holley (September 7, 1936 – February 3, 1959), known professionally as
Buddy Holly, was an American musician and singer-songwriter and a pioneer of rock and roll. Although his success lasted only a year and a half before his death in an airplane crash, Holly is described by critic Bruce Eder as "the single most influential creative force in early rock and roll."[SUP][/SUP] His works and innovations inspired and influenced contemporary and later musicians, notably the Beatles, Elvis Costello, the Rolling Stones, and Bob Dylan, and exerted a profound influence on popular music.[SUP][/SUP] In 2004,
Rolling Stone magazine ranked Holly number 13 on its list of the 100 greatest artists of all time.[SUP][/SUP]
